WebiRacing is a subscription-based online racing simulation video game developed and published by iRacing.com Motorsport Simulations in 2008. All in-game sessions are hosted on the publisher's servers. The game simulates real world cars, tracks, and racing events, and enforces rules of conduct modeled on real auto racing events. WebJul 1, 2014 · At the beginning of each season, the iRacing.com system will automatically partition drivers into 10 (or 11 when appropriate) competition divisions based on the previous season ending iRatings. 4.4.1.3.
